地址解析,网站地址解析
在互联网的世界里,我们每天都会与无数个网站打交道。而这一切的背后,都离不开地址解析这一关键环节。什么是地址解析?它是如何工作的?小编将深入探讨地址解析的奥秘,带您了解网站地址解析的全过程。
1.域名解析的定义与作用
域名解析是将人类易于理解的域名转化为计算机能够理解的I地址的过程。I地址是网络上标识站点的数字地址,为了方便记忆,采用域名来代替I地址标识站点地址。域名解析就是域名到I地址的转换过程。
2.域名解析的工作原理
域名的解析工作由DNS服务器完成。DNS(DomainNameSystem,域名系统)是一种分布式数据库,它将域名映射到对应的I地址。当我们输入一个域名时,DNS服务器会将其解析为相应的I地址,然后我们的计算机就可以通过这个I地址与网站服务器进行通信。
3.域名解析的流程
域名解析的过程可以分为多个步骤:
1.用户输入域名:当用户在浏览器中输入一个域名时,例如www.examle.com,浏览器会将这个域名发送给本地DNS服务器。
2.查询本地缓存:本地DNS服务器首先会检查是否有该域名的缓存记录,如果有,则直接返回对应的I地址。
3.查询根域名服务器:如果本地缓存中没有该域名的记录,本地DNS服务器会向根域名服务器发送查询请求,根域名服务器会返回负责该域名的顶级域名服务器地址。
4.查询顶级域名服务器:本地DNS服务器根据根域名服务器返回的地址,向顶级域名服务器发送查询请求,顶级域名服务器会返回该域名所在域的权威域名服务器地址。
5.查询权威域名服务器:本地DNS服务器根据顶级域名服务器返回的地址,向权威域名服务器发送查询请求,权威域名服务器会返回该域名的I地址。
6.返回I地址:权威域名服务器将I地址返回给本地DNS服务器,本地DNS服务器再将I地址返回给浏览器。4.域名解析的重要性
域名解析是互联网运行的基础,它的重要性体现在以下几个方面:
-方便记忆:使用域名代替I地址,使得用户可以更方便地访问网站。
提高安全性:通过DNS安全协议(DNSSEC),可以防止DNS劫持等安全威胁。
提高效率:域名解析可以减少用户在访问网站时输入I地址的麻烦,提高访问效率。5.域名解析的应用场景
域名解析在日常生活中有着广泛的应用,以下是一些常见的应用场景:
-网站访问:用户通过浏览器输入域名,访问网站。
电子邮件发送:发送电子邮件时,需要解析收件人的域名,以确定对方的邮件服务器地址。
网络通信:网络设备之间通过解析域名,实现相互通信。地址解析是互联网运行不可或缺的一环。通过域名解析,我们可以在方便快捷地访问网站的保障网络安全和通信效率。了解地址解析的原理和流程,有助于我们更好地认识互联网,享受科技带来的便利。